MOLLETES

We like to eat molletes for breakfast, so I'll usually make the beans ahead of time and refrigerate them until we're ready to assemble the toast.

Steps:

  • Place beans in a saucepan and add enough water to cover them by 1 inch. Bring to a boil and remove from heat. Let stand for 1 hour.
  • Drain and rinse beans. Add enough fresh water to cover by 1 inch. Bring to a boil, reduce heat, and simmer for 2 hours. Drain, reserving 1/2 cup of the cooking water, and rinse.
  • Heat o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Add beans and salt. Fry until beans are very soft, stirring and mashing frequently, 5 to 7 minutes.
  • Set an oven rack about 6 inches from the heat source and preheat the oven's broiler on low heat.
  • Spread an equal amount of beans on each slice of bread and sprinkle queso on top. Place bread slices on a baking sheet.
  • Broil until beans are warmed and cheese is melted, about 3 minutes. Remove from oven and top with chile-garlic sauce.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 318.2 calories, Carbohydrate 43.8 g, Cholesterol 10 mg, Fat 8.2 g, Fiber 8.6 g, Protein 17.1 g, SaturatedFat 2.6 g, Sodium 1171.3 mg, Sugar 3.8 g

8 ounces dried pinto beans
2 tablespoons olive oil
1 ½ teaspoons salt
16 slices white whole wheat bread
1 cup shredded queso blanco
⅓ cup chile-garlic sauce (such as Sriracha®)

TRADITIONAL MEXICAN MOLLETES

A traditional Mexican open sandwich with refried beans and melted cheese served with salsa. Perfect for breakfast, lunch, or as a tasty snack.

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Line a rimmed baking sheet with parchment paper.
  • Remove some of the bread from the middle of bread halves to accommodate more toppings. Spread about 1 teaspoon butter on each half.
  • Spread 2 to 3 tablespoons warmed refried beans on bread. Sprinkle about 1/4 cup Borden® Cheddar and Monterey Jack shredded cheese on the beans. Place bread halves on prepared baking sheet.
  • Bake in preheated oven until the cheese is melted and bubbly and the bread is crispy, 15 to 20 minutes.
  • Top molletes with Mexican salsa or pico de gallo.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 698.5 calories, Carbohydrate 85.3 g, Cholesterol 77.1 mg, Fat 26.1 g, Fiber 9 g, Protein 28 g, SaturatedFat 15.3 g, Sodium 1022.5 mg, Sugar 5.5 g

4 bolillo rolls, sliced in half lengthwise
3 tablespoons butter, room temperature
1 (16 ounce) can refried beans, heated
1 (7 ounce) package Borden® Southwestern Cheddar & Monterey Jack Shredded Cheese
Mexican salsa or pico de gallo, for serving

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ven or toaster oven to 500°F.
  • Heat a large pan over medium heat until it's nice and hot. Spread the butter over the cut sides of the roll halves. Place them, cut sides down, in the pan and cook until they are lightly golden brown and crispy, a minute or two.
  • Spread a thin layer of beans over the toasted side of each roll. Top with a thin layer of cheese. Cook the molletes (open-faced) in the oven just until the cheese has melted and turned golden brown in a few spots, 3 to 5 minutes.
  • Serve the molletes beside a bowl of the pico de gallo and let everyone top the molletes with pico de gallo themselves.

1 tablespoon unsalted butter, softened
2 large rolls, preferably teleras, Portuguese, kaiser, or ciabatta, split
Generous 1/4 cup Refried Black Beans, homemade or canned
6 ounces Chihuahua cheese or provolone cheese, shredded
Generous 1/2 cup Pico de Gallo with Lemon Zest
